Aneesh Kumar K.V
|
4dc71451a2
mm/follow_page_mask: add support for hugepage directory entry
|
8 years ago |
Anshuman Khandual
|
faaa5b62d3
mm/follow_page_mask: add support for hugetlb pgd entries
|
8 years ago |
Aneesh Kumar K.V
|
d5ed7444da
mm/hugetlb: export hugetlb_entry_migration helper
|
8 years ago |
Anshuman Khandual
|
94310cbcaa
mm/madvise: enable (soft|hard) offline of HugeTLB pages at PGD level
|
8 years ago |
James Morse
|
9a291a7c94
mm/hugetlb: report -EHWPOISON not -EFAULT when FOLL_HWPOISON is specified
|
8 years ago |
Mike Kravetz
|
ff8c0c53c4
mm/hugetlb.c: don't call region_abort if region_chg fails
|
8 years ago |
Naoya Horiguchi
|
c9d398fa23
mm, hugetlb: use pte_present() instead of pmd_present() in follow_huge_pmd()
|
8 years ago |
Kirill A. Shutemov
|
c2febafc67
mm: convert generic code to 5-level paging
|
8 years ago |
Ingo Molnar
|
174cd4b1e5
sched/headers: Prepare to move signal wakeup & sigpending methods from <linux/sched.h> into <linux/sched/signal.h>
|
8 years ago |
Lucas Stach
|
ca96b62534
mm: alloc_contig_range: allow to specify GFP mask
|
8 years ago |
Dave Jiang
|
11bac80004
mm, fs: reduce fault, page_mkwrite, and pfn_mkwrite to take only vmf
|
8 years ago |
Mike Kravetz
|
1c9e8def43
userfaultfd: hugetlbfs: add UFFDIO_COPY support for shared mappings
|
8 years ago |
Andrea Arcangeli
|
87ffc118b5
userfaultfd: hugetlbfs: gup: support VM_FAULT_RETRY
|
8 years ago |
Mike Kravetz
|
1a1aad8a9b
userfaultfd: hugetlbfs: add userfaultfd hugetlb hook
|
8 years ago |
Mike Kravetz
|
810a56b943
userfaultfd: hugetlbfs: fix __mcopy_atomic_hugetlb retry/error processing
|
8 years ago |
Mike Kravetz
|
8fb5debc5f
userfaultfd: hugetlbfs: add hugetlb_mcopy_atomic_pte for userfaultfd support
|
8 years ago |
Mike Kravetz
|
e5bbc8a6c9
mm/hugetlb.c: fix reservation race when freeing surplus pages
|
8 years ago |
Aneesh Kumar K.V
|
07e326610e
mm: add tlb_remove_check_page_size_change to track page size change
|
8 years ago |
Aneesh Kumar K.V
|
b528e4b640
mm/hugetlb: add tlb_remove_hugetlb_entry for handling hugetlb pages
|
8 years ago |
Aneesh Kumar K.V
|
8bea805207
mm/hugetlb.c: use huge_pte_lock instead of opencoding the lock
|
8 years ago |
Aneesh Kumar K.V
|
3999f52e31
mm/hugetlb.c: use the right pte val for compare in hugetlb_cow
|
8 years ago |
Mike Kravetz
|
96b96a96dd
mm/hugetlb: fix huge page reservation leak in private mapping error paths
|
8 years ago |
zhong jiang
|
72e2936c04
mm: remove unnecessary condition in remove_inode_hugepages
|
9 years ago |
Yisheng Xie
|
461a718432
mm/hugetlb: introduce ARCH_HAS_GIGANTIC_PAGE
|
9 years ago |
Gerald Schaefer
|
eb03aa0085
mm/hugetlb: improve locking in dissolve_free_huge_pages()
|
9 years ago |
Gerald Schaefer
|
082d5b6b60
mm/hugetlb: check for reserved hugepages during memory offline
|
9 years ago |
Gerald Schaefer
|
2247bb335a
mm/hugetlb: fix memory offline with hugepage size > memory block size
|
9 years ago |
zhong jiang
|
c1470b33bb
mm/hugetlb: fix incorrect hugepages count during mem hotplug
|
9 years ago |
Linus Torvalds
|
2cfd716d27
Merge tag 'powerpc-4.8-2' of git://git.kernel.org/pub/scm/linux/kernel/git/powerpc/linux
|
9 years ago |
Michal Hocko
|
4e666314d2
mm, hugetlb: fix huge_pte_alloc BUG_ON
|
9 years ago |